时间:2024-04-03 来源:网络整理 人气:
在PHP编程中,数组冒泡排序是一种常见且简单的排序算法。它通过比较相邻元素并交换位置来实现排序,直至整个数组按照升序或降序排列。首先,我们需要一个待排序的数组,然后使用嵌套的循环来实现冒泡排序的过程。
具体实现步骤如下:
1.遍历数组,比较相邻元素的大小。
2.如果前一个元素大于后一个元素,则交换它们的位置。
3.继续这个过程,直到没有任何元素需要交换。
下面是一个简单的PHP代码示例:
php $arr[$j+1]){ //交换位置 $temp =$arr[$j]; $arr[$j]=$arr[$j+1]; $arr[$j+1]=$temp; } } } return $arr; } //测试 $arr =[64, 34, 25, 12, 22, 11, 90]; $result = bubbleSort($arr); print_r($result); ?>
通过以上代码,我们可以实现对数组的冒泡排序。这种算法虽然简单但是效率较低,在处理大量数据时会变得缓慢。因此,在实际应用中,可能会选择更高效的排序算法。
imtoken官网版下载:https://cjge-manuscriptcentral.com/software/66002.html